Matlab syms a b c x1 x2 x3 x4 x5 y1 y2 y3 y4 y5 z1 z2[a,b,c,x1,x2,x3,x4,x5,y1,y2,y3,y4,y5,z1,z2]=solve('z1cos(a+b*1.867-c)=x1','z2cos(a+b*1.867-c)=y1','x1+y1=0.22','z1cos(a+b*9.15-c)=x2','z2cos(a+b*9.15-c)=y2','x2+y2=-0.284','z1cos(a+b*16.37-c)=x3','

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/05 20:58:23
Matlab syms a b c x1 x2 x3 x4 x5 y1 y2 y3 y4 y5 z1 z2[a,b,c,x1,x2,x3,x4,x5,y1,y2,y3,y4,y5,z1,z2]=solve('z1cos(a+b*1.867-c)=x1','z2cos(a+b*1.867-c)=y1','x1+y1=0.22','z1cos(a+b*9.15-c)=x2','z2cos(a+b*9.15-c)=y2','x2+y2=-0.284','z1cos(a+b*16.37-c)=x3','

Matlab syms a b c x1 x2 x3 x4 x5 y1 y2 y3 y4 y5 z1 z2[a,b,c,x1,x2,x3,x4,x5,y1,y2,y3,y4,y5,z1,z2]=solve('z1cos(a+b*1.867-c)=x1','z2cos(a+b*1.867-c)=y1','x1+y1=0.22','z1cos(a+b*9.15-c)=x2','z2cos(a+b*9.15-c)=y2','x2+y2=-0.284','z1cos(a+b*16.37-c)=x3','
Matlab
syms a b c x1 x2 x3 x4 x5 y1 y2 y3 y4 y5 z1 z2
[a,b,c,x1,x2,x3,x4,x5,y1,y2,y3,y4,y5,z1,z2]=solve('z1cos(a+b*1.867-c)=x1','z2cos(a+b*1.867-c)=y1','x1+y1=0.22','z1cos(a+b*9.15-c)=x2','z2cos(a+b*9.15-c)=y2','x2+y2=-0.284','z1cos(a+b*16.37-c)=x3','z2cos(a+b*16.37-c)=y3','x3+y3=0.27','z1cos(a+b*22.4-c)=x4','z2cos(a+b*22.4-c)=y4','x4+y4=-0.18','z1cos(a+b*26.8-c)=x5','z2cos(a+b*26.8-c)=y5','x5+y5=0.11')
以上是Matlab程序,为什么说我
Warning:15 equations in 13 variables.
> In solve at 113
Warning:Warning,solutions may have been lost
Warning:Explicit solution could not be found.
> In solve at 140
错在哪?急

Matlab syms a b c x1 x2 x3 x4 x5 y1 y2 y3 y4 y5 z1 z2[a,b,c,x1,x2,x3,x4,x5,y1,y2,y3,y4,y5,z1,z2]=solve('z1cos(a+b*1.867-c)=x1','z2cos(a+b*1.867-c)=y1','x1+y1=0.22','z1cos(a+b*9.15-c)=x2','z2cos(a+b*9.15-c)=y2','x2+y2=-0.284','z1cos(a+b*16.37-c)=x3','
乘号都不加,不出错才怪

Matlab syms a b c x1 x2 x3 x4 x5 y1 y2 y3 y4 y5 z1 z2[a,b,c,x1,x2,x3,x4,x5,y1,y2,y3,y4,y5,z1,z2]=solve('z1cos(a+b*1.867-c)=x1','z2cos(a+b*1.867-c)=y1','x1+y1=0.22','z1cos(a+b*9.15-c)=x2','z2cos(a+b*9.15-c)=y2','x2+y2=-0.284','z1cos(a+b*16.37-c)=x3',' MATLAB定义多个符号变量我知道定义几个的时候syms a b c t;%定义多个符号变量但是定义比较多,例如我有x1,x2,.x100个变量这时该怎么定义呢? matlab解符号方程syms a b c d;f1=a +b+c+d;f2=2*a+4*d+3*c+5*d;f3=4*a+b+3*c+2*d;f=solve(f1,f2,f3) 结果为f = b: [1x1 sym] c: [1x1 sym] d: [1x1 sym] 默认是用a来表示b c d的.但是我想用d来表示a b c,应该怎么办? matlab 解方程组 总是返回1*1 sym.输入内容:syms a b c e2 e3 e4;I=a^2/2+6/5*a*b+4/3*a*c+3/4*b^2+12/7*b*c+c^2-(e2*a+e3*b+e4*c);x=diff(I,a);y=diff(I,b);z=diff(I,c);S=solve(x,y,z,a,b,c)输出:S =a:[1x1 sym]b:[1x1 sym]c:[1x1 sym]我想得出 如何用Matlab画含积分函数式子的图形syms x1 Q_N;p = 125; w = 80; w2 = 85; c = 35; c2 = 50; v = 20; h = 10; a = 130; b = 1;rate = [10 12 28 22 18 10];demand = 5500:200:6500;r = sum(rate); AVG = rate * demand'/r matlab程序运行总是出现? Error using ==> sym.mpower Matrix must be square. 加了“.”还是不行呀m=zeros(1,50);a=zeros(1,50);b=zeros(1,50);f0=zeros(1,50); syms d x1 x2 e; m(1)=1;c= matlab syms 运行出错>> syms x a b c f=sym('a*x^2+b*x+c')findsym(f,4)y(1)=limit(f,x,1)y(2)=limit(f,1)y(3)=limit(f,a,2)y(4)=limit(f,b,1)yAttempt to execute SCRIPT syms as a function.Error in ==> jixian at 1syms x a b c 请问是为什么呢? matlab 最速下降法求解clc;clear;disp('最速下降法')syms x1 x2 lam;x=[x1 x2];t=0; X0=[1;1]; y=(x1^2+x2-11)^2+(x1+x2^2-7)^2;e=0.01;for n=1:10 a=subs(diff(y,x1),x,X0); b=subs(diff(y,x2),x,X0); yj=[a;b]; z=subs(y,x,X0-lam*y matlab 程序出错syms a b c;M1=sym('kiu');M2=sym('kog');M3=sym('lou');syms_matrix=syms_matrix=[a b c;M1,M2,M3;int2str([2 3 5])] matlab中我想用输入t表示一个数来计算二次方程的交点啊?clccleart=input('t=?');syms x yeq1=(x-14-t)^2+(y-290)^2-160^2=0;eq2= x^2+y^2-190^2=0 ;[x,y]=solve(eq1,eq2)a=vpa(x(1),10)b=vpa(x(2),10)c=vpa(S.y(1),10)d=vpa(S.y(2),10)x1=min(dou Matlab出现内部矩阵维度不一致?x1=1:10:100;a=46+0.12*x1+((6-0.12*x1).^2*(46+0.12*x1))./(36-(6-0.12*x1).^2);b=(10-0.3*x1)*x1;c=25-1.8*((6-0.12*x1)*(46+0.12*x1))./(36-(6-0.12*x1).^2);y=7./64*a.^2+b+c;plot(x1,y);在matlab中怎么算不出来, MATLAB 中syms 7A+18.2B+43.03C=48.7918.2A+45.03B+190.472C=144.66143.03A+190.472B+677.8756C=488.9851syms x1 x2 x3 f1=7*x1+18.2*x2+43.03*x3=48.79;f2=18.2*x1+45.03*x2+190.472*x3=144.661;f3=43.03*x1+190.472*x2+677.8756*x3=488.9851;[x1,x2,x3]=solve(f1,f2,f3)直接在mat matlab中用循环绘制a与c的关系曲线.求大神相助,急用啊.syms a cfor a=10:5:30x1=0:0.001:a/2y1=3*x1+1x2=a/2:0.001:ay2=-3*x2+10[y1_max]=max(y1)[y2_max]=max(y2)c=max([y1_max,y2_max])plot(a,c)end其中c表示在不同a的取值时,函数y1 matlab初学者,麻烦给解个三角函数的方程,我的怎么没有解呀?syms a b c>> [a,b,c]=solve('cos(a)*sin(b)*cos(c)+sin(a)*sin(c)=0.2082','sin(a)*sin(b)*cos(c)-cos(a)*sin(c)=0.71937','cos(b)*cos(c)=0.6691') matlab 如何画圆syms a b;ezplot( (2-a).^2+(50-b).^2 );为什么这样画只能出现一个点?不能出现一个圆syms a b;ezplot( (2-a).^2+(50-b).^2-1 );这样子也不可以 matlab中syms类型画图,小白如何画出图形并标出极值点syms a b; >> fi=(1600*cot(b)*(1+1/sin(b)))/240+((1/cos((a-b)/2))*(1600-1600*cot(b)*cot(b)) Matlab syms a b c d[a,b,c,d,]=solve('cos(a+b+c*d)=5','cos(a+b-c*d)=6','cos(a-b+c*d)=7','cos(a+b+c/d)=8')这是Matlab程序,为什么说我Error using ==> solve at 77' cos(a-b+c*d)=7 ' is not a valid expression or equation.错在哪?急